1. Regular Oil Changes

Changing your vehicle’s oil is one of the most critical aspects of routine maintenance. Fresh oil lubricates your engine, prevents overheating, and reduces friction between parts. At Wilson Motorsports, we recommend changing your oil every 3,000 to 7,500 miles, depending on the type of oil and your driving habits. Regular oil changes are an easy and affordable way to keep your engine in top shape and extend its life.


2. Tire Care & Rotation

Tires are the only point of contact between your vehicle and the road, so proper tire maintenance is essential for safety and performance. We suggest checking tire pressure at least once a month to ensure they're properly inflated. Underinflated or overinflated tires can affect fuel efficiency and handling. Additionally, rotating your tires every 6,000 to 8,000 miles promotes even wear and ensures that your vehicle handles well. If you notice any signs of damage, such as punctures or uneven tread wear, it’s time to visit us for an inspection.


3. Brake System Inspections

Your brake system is crucial to your safety on the road. Worn brake pads or low brake fluid can significantly impact your vehicle’s ability to stop efficiently. At Wilson Motorsports, we offer comprehensive brake system inspections to check the condition of pads, rotors, and fluid. If you hear squeaking or grinding noises, it’s a clear sign that your brakes need attention. Having your brakes checked regularly can prevent costly repairs and keep you and your passengers safe.


4. Battery Maintenance

A dead battery can leave you stranded, so it’s important to inspect your battery regularly. At Wilson Motorsports, we offer battery testing and can clean the terminals to prevent corrosion. If your battery is 3 years or older, it’s a good idea to have it checked for efficiency. If you notice dimming headlights or difficulty starting your car, it could be a sign that your battery needs to be replaced.


5. Fluid Levels & Leaks

Your vehicle relies on a variety of fluids to operate correctly, including engine coolant, transmission fluid, power steering fluid, and brake fluid. Keeping an eye on fluid levels and topping them off as needed is crucial for preventing engine overheating, poor performance, and unnecessary repairs. We also recommend having your fluids inspected regularly for leaks, which could be a sign of a more serious problem. If you notice any spots under your car or unusual fluid smells, give us a call at Wilson Motorsports for a quick inspection.


6. Air Filter & Cabin Filter Replacement

Your engine needs a clean air supply to run efficiently, and your air filter plays a key role in providing that. A dirty air filter can reduce fuel efficiency and engine performance. Likewise, the cabin air filter ensures the air inside your car is clean and free from allergens, dust, and pollutants. Replacing both filters regularly (usually every 12,000 to 15,000 miles) will help maintain good engine health and air quality inside your vehicle.


7. Belts & Hoses

The belts and hoses in your vehicle help power critical systems, such as the engine cooling and air conditioning. Over time, belts can crack or wear, and hoses can develop leaks. Regular inspection is essential for preventing sudden breakdowns. At Wilson Motorsports, we can inspect your vehicle’s belts and hoses for signs of wear and replace them before they cause a problem, saving you from costly repairs and keeping your vehicle running smoothly.


8. Suspension & Steering System

Your suspension system ensures a smooth ride and proper handling. It includes components such as shocks, struts, and springs, which are essential for controlling your vehicle’s stability on the road. If you notice your vehicle bouncing excessively, pulling to one side, or making strange noises, it's time for a suspension inspection. We also check your steering system to ensure safe, responsive handling.


9. Timing Belt/Chain Replacement

The timing belt or chain ensures that your engine’s camshaft and crankshaft rotate in sync. If this critical part fails, it can cause severe engine damage. Many vehicles require a timing belt replacement every 60,000 to 100,000 miles, depending on the make and model. At Wilson Motorsports, we recommend staying on top of this maintenance to avoid a costly and unexpected repair.
